奇狐社區論壇
在這個頁面顯示本主題全部的 6 個文章

奇狐社區論壇 (http://www.chiefox.com.tw/bbs/index.php)
- 問題交流 (http://www.chiefox.com.tw/bbs/forumdisplay.php?forumid=28)
-- 如何獲得多單進場時那根K棒的收盤價和當時的KD值 (http://www.chiefox.com.tw/bbs/showthread.php?threadid=15794)


由 DUNHILL 在 2011-06-29 16:46 發表:

如何獲得多單進場時那根K棒的收盤價和當時的KD值

事隔多年,以前曾請教過

http://www.chiefox.com.tw/bbs/showt...&threadid=10801

再進一步請教

若我出場條件是

ma20<ma60; 或 進場時的K植+30

要怎麼寫


由 cgjj 在 2011-06-29 16:53 發表:

回覆: 如何獲得多單進場時那根K棒的收盤價和當時的KD值

引用:
最初由 DUNHILL 發表
事隔多年,以前曾請教過

http://www.chiefox.com.tw/bbs/showt...&threadid=10801

再進一步請教

若我出場條件是

ma20<ma60; 或 進場時的K植+30

要怎麼寫




進場時的K植+30

是指 現在的K > 進場的K+30 就出場嗎?


由 DUNHILL 在 2011-07-05 23:53 發表:

+30應該是-ˇ30比較合理,就是K值比進場時少30時就出場

=================================
我沒受過專業訓練,只會寫流水帳式的簡單程式
其實,我的問題是:我的出場條件,若是要用到進場時的某個數據,怎麼表達?

而依版大所教的,要進場時的某個數據前,要先有出場的訊號,才能推算出我要的數據

這我就不知怎麼辦了?


由 cgjj 在 2011-07-06 09:18 發表:

引用:
最初由 DUNHILL 發表
+30應該是-ˇ30比較合理,就是K值比進場時少30時就出場

=================================
我沒受過專業訓練,只會寫流水帳式的簡單程式
其實,我的問題是:我的出場條件,若是要用到進場時的某個數據,怎麼表達?

而依版大所教的,要進場時的某個數據前,要先有出場的訊號,才能推算出我要的數據

這我就不知怎麼辦了?




進K:=ref(K,barslast(進場)); //求進場時的K值
出場:=進K-K>30;


由 DUNHILL 在 2011-07-06 15:24 發表:

多進:=ma20>ma60;

上一次MA20>ma60的時間 未必是我進場的時間

第一次ma20>ma60時 進場,但在未出場前

ma20>ma60可能發生好幾次

版大的解答 好像不能解決這個問題


由 cgjj 在 2011-07-06 15:39 發表:

引用:
最初由 DUNHILL 發表
多進:=ma20>ma60;

上一次MA20>ma60的時間 未必是我進場的時間

第一次ma20>ma60時 進場,但在未出場前

ma20>ma60可能發生好幾次

版大的解答 好像不能解決這個問題



那麼您不能把 ma20>ma60 直接帶入到, 以下這行的 "進場" 當中
進K:=ref(K,barslast(進場));

因為並非每次ma20>ma60發生時您都會進場


有完整的實例
才比較容易了解您的問題協助您唷


全部時間均為台灣時間, 現在時間為22:04
在這個頁面顯示本主題全部的 6 個文章


Powered by: vBulletin Version 2.3.0 - Copyright©2000-, Jelsoft Enterprises Limited.

簡愛洋行 製作 Copyright 2003-. All Rights Reserved.